Pular para o conteúdo

Os usuários do Linux

Este é um artigo simples onde tento mostrar como o Linux trabalha com usuários e grupos, visto que essa é uma dúvida bem comum dentre as pessoas que costumam aparecer no canal de IRC #Vivaolinux.
Luiz Antonio da Silva Junior JuNiOx
Hits: 108.189 Categoria: Linux Subcategoria: Introdução
  • Indicar
  • Impressora
  • Denunciar
O Viva o Linux depende da receita de anúncios para se manter. Ative os cookies aqui para nos patrocinar.
Não conseguimos carregar os anúncios. Se usa bloqueador, considere liberar o Viva o Linux para nos patrocinar.

Introdução

Já que o Linux é um sistema operacional multi-usuário, ele pode ter mais que um usuário conectado simultaneamente e cada um deles pode conectar-se mais de uma vez no mesmo momento.

Nesse artigo veremos os seguintes tópicos:
  • /etc/passwd - arquivo responsável por armazenar dados dos usuários.
  • Tipos de usuários - entenda quais os tipos de usuários que existem no Linux.
  • Grupos - como funcionam os grupos de usuários.


O Viva o Linux depende da receita de anúncios para se manter. Ative os cookies aqui para nos patrocinar.
Não conseguimos carregar os anúncios. Se usa bloqueador, considere liberar o Viva o Linux para nos patrocinar.
O Viva o Linux depende da receita de anúncios para se manter. Ative os cookies aqui para nos patrocinar.
Não conseguimos carregar os anúncios. Se usa bloqueador, considere liberar o Viva o Linux para nos patrocinar.
   1. Introdução
   2. Como funciona o /etc/passwd?
   3. Tipos de usuários
   4. Grupos

Instalando e Configurando o JAVA

Configurando TomCat

#Vivaolinux, agora com canal IRC

Analisando arquivos de registro (log)

O movimento do código aberto

Como instalar programas no Linux

Tumbleweed, o openSUSE Rolling Release

Chakra Linux - Apresentação, instalação e configuração

Instalando o Fedore Core 4

Questão de LPIC - Manipulação de dispositivos

#1 Comentário enviado por elm em 31/10/2003 - 07:19h
Uma opção interessante que pode ser utilizada é a criação de um usuário sem que seja permitido seu login no sistema via ssh/telnet.
Para isso é só modificar sua shell para /bin/false, como no exemplo:

xfs:*:100:101:X Font Server:/etc/X11/fs:/bin/false

Isso é bastante usado em provedores onde uma conta de usuário pode ser utilizada para leitura de e-mails,por exemplo, mas não é interessante que ela possa fazer o login no sistema.
#2 Comentário enviado por mrluk em 11/11/2003 - 10:01h
para essa função ser mais eficaz, podemos tb, criar o arquivo /etc/nologin , curto, grosso e vazio! hehe

Este arquivo estando no /etc impede que qualquer usuário (com excessão do root) faça login no sistema, inclusive remotamente! Muito util para servidores!

;o)

Um grande abraço,

MrLuk
#3 Comentário enviado por mrluk em 11/11/2003 - 10:05h
para essa função ser mais eficaz, podemos tb, criar o arquivo /etc/nologin , curto, grosso e vazio! hehe

Este arquivo estando no /etc impede que qualquer usuário (com excessão do root) faça login no sistema, inclusive remotamente! Muito util para servidores!

;o)

Um grande abraço,

MrLuk
#4 Comentário enviado por fb em 08/06/2004 - 18:11h

Valeria comentar o shadow.
#5 Comentário enviado por Trebolle em 23/11/2017 - 10:58h
Bom dia amigos
Prezados, podem tirar uma dúvida para mim?
Quando eu entro como root e digito cd /etc/passwd estou obtendo como resposta "Permission denied"
Porém, se eu entrar no diretorio /etc e digitar cat passwd, aí sim me mostra todas as informações.
Já tentei com outro usuário e não consigo. Sabe porque desta mensagem Permission denied?
Obrigado

Contribuir com comentário

Entre na sua conta para comentar.